The Client Lifecycle, Automated
Every client moves through the same four stages. I automate each one so nothing depends on someone remembering to follow up.
Booking Request
Every inquiry, whether it comes in on WhatsApp, Instagram, or a booking page, gets an instant confirmation — no client waits to hear back, even if it comes in after closing time or during a fully booked afternoon. In a market where a client can just as easily message the salon down the street, whoever confirms first usually keeps the booking, so this first response matters almost as much as the appointment itself.
Pre-Visit Confirmation
An automated confirmation goes out ahead of the appointment naming the stylist, chair, and service booked, so staff can prep the right products in advance instead of finding out what's needed the moment the client walks in. A second reminder closer to the appointment gives the client an easy way to confirm or reschedule, which is where most of the drop in no-shows actually happens.
Visit & Retail Log
The appointment happens, and the system logs the exact service performed and any retail product sold, so the next stage knows exactly when to follow up. This is the detail most manual systems skip — without it, every client gets the same generic "come back soon" message regardless of whether they had a quick trim or a full color treatment, which is exactly what makes automated rebooking feel like a personal touch rather than a mass blast.
Rebooking & Restock Window
Rebooking and retail restock messages go out on a schedule matched to that specific service or product's typical cycle, not a flat 30-day blast. A client due for a root touch-up in four weeks and one due for a facial in eight weeks each get contacted on their own timeline, and if they don't respond, a follow-up nudge goes out before that window closes rather than after they've already booked somewhere else.

What This Looks Like in Practice
To make this concrete, here's an illustrative walkthrough of how the pieces connect. A client books a balayage appointment through an Instagram DM on a Tuesday evening. Within seconds, an automated reply confirms the date, time, and stylist, and a follow-up message two days before the appointment reminds them with a one-tap option to reschedule if something comes up. After the appointment, the system logs that it was a color service, so eight weeks later — not thirty days, not a random date — the client gets a friendly rebooking message timed to when a color treatment like theirs typically needs a touch-up. If they don't respond within a few days, a shorter nudge goes out before that window closes.
None of this requires the front desk to remember who's due for what. This is a hypothetical example meant to show how the stages connect, not a guarantee of outcomes for any specific salon — the actual cadence is tuned to the services a business actually offers.
